Microsoft Excel: Dashboards
A Dashboard is a visual, dynamic, summary / overview of a business, set out on one spreadsheet using graphs and tables.
Dashboards analyse and display an overview of your data quickly and easily in an attractive and dynamic way highlighting KPIs and other essential records.
ADVANTAGES INCLUDE:
- Direct focus on KPIs
- Summarise large quantities of data
- Contain a combination of graphs, tables and other visual images
- Dynamic, allowing the user to select which data to display at any time using Slicers and Timelines
- Easy to update and change when new data is added
- Assist in making quick and reliable business decisions
- Help keep track of business performance
